What to Look for in an Automatic Vacuum Cleaner: Key Features and Considerations
Choosing the best automatic Vacuum [internationalsportsawards.com] cleaner involves considering numerous aspects to ensure it efficiently meets your cleaning needs and integrates flawlessly into your way of life. Here are some vital aspects to evaluate before purchasing:
Navigation System: A robot vacuum's navigation system is its brain, determining how effectively and efficiently it cleans your floors. Different types of navigation exist:
- Random/Bounce Navigation: Older and typically economical designs utilize this system. They move arbitrarily, bouncing off obstacles till the battery is low. While they eventually cover the area, their cleaning patterns are less efficient and can miss out on spots.
- Methodical Navigation (Row-by-Row): These vacuums clean in straight lines, systematically covering a location. They are more efficient than random navigation and provide much better coverage.
- L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) Navigation: Utilizing lasers, LiDAR produces in-depth maps of your home. This permits for extremely efficient and systematic cleaning, smart course preparation, and functions like room-specific cleaning and virtual boundaries.
- Camera-Based S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) Navigation: These vacuums use video cameras to visually map their surroundings. They use comparable smart features to LiDAR, however their efficiency can be impacted by lighting conditions.
Suction Power: The strength of a robot vacuum's suction determines its capability to get dirt, dust, particles, and pet hair from various floor types. Greater suction power is generally much better, especially for carpets and homes with pets. Try to find specs like Pascal (Pa) score to compare suction levels in between models.
Battery Life and Coverage Area: Battery life determines how long a robot vacuum can run on a single charge. Consider the size of your home and pick a design with adequate battery life to cover your cleaning location. Some advanced designs include automatic charging and resume, returning to the charging dock when low and after that resuming cleaning where they ended.
Functions and Functionality: Beyond basic vacuuming, many robot vacuums use extra features that enhance their convenience and cleaning abilities:
- Mopping Functionality: Some hybrid designs integrate vacuuming and mopping, offering a 2-in-1 cleaning service. These might consist of separate water tanks and mopping pads.
- Self-Emptying Dustbins: Premium models come with self-emptying bases. The robot vacuum immediately clears its dustbin into a bigger bin in the base, decreasing the frequency of manual emptying.
- App Control and Smart Home Integration: Wi-Fi connectivity allows control through smart device apps. Functions might include scheduling cleansings, adjusting suction levels, seeing cleaning maps, setting virtual limits, and incorporating with voice assistants like Alexa or Google Assistant.
- Floor Type Detection: Smart vacuums can detect various floor types (hardwood, carpet, carpets) and change suction power instantly for ideal cleaning.
- Barrier Avoidance and Object Recognition: Advanced sensing units and AI algorithms help robot vacuums that mop vacuums navigate around furniture, pet bowls, and even determine and prevent smaller sized things like shoes or cables, avoiding them from getting stuck or dragging items around.
Upkeep and Durability: Consider the ease of maintenance, such as clearing the dustbin, cleaning brushes, and changing filters. Try to find designs with quickly accessible parts and readily available replacement parts. Check out reviews relating to the vacuum's resilience and dependability.
Price and Value: Robot vacuums range in price from affordable to premium. Determine your spending plan and balance features and efficiency with expense. Consider the long-lasting worth of a robot vacuum in terms of time conserved and benefit.

Benefits of Using an Automatic Vacuum Cleaner
Purchasing an automatic vacuum deals numerous benefits that extend beyond simply having cleaner floors. Here are some crucial advantages:
- Time Savings and Convenience: The most considerable benefit is unquestionably the time and effort saved. Robot vacuums automate a tiresome chore, maximizing your time for more pleasurable activities.
- Constant Cleaning Schedules: You can schedule your robot vacuum to clean while you are at work or asleep, guaranteeing regularly clean floors without any mindful effort.
- Improved Air Quality: Many robot vacuums are equipped with HEPA filters that trap irritants, dust mites, and pet dander, adding to much better indoor air quality, especially useful for allergy patients.
- Accessibility for Elderly and People with Mobility Issues: Robot vacuums make floor cleaning easier for individuals who might have difficulty with standard vacuums due to age or mobility limitations.
- Smart Home Integration and Automation: Modern robot vacuums flawlessly integrate with smart home communities, permitting voice control and personalized cleaning routines, further boosting home automation.
Tips for Maximizing Your Robot Vacuum's Performance
To guarantee your automatic vacuum runs effectively and lasts longer, follow these basic tips:
- Regular Maintenance: Empty the dustbin routinely, tidy brushes and rollers of hair and particles, and replace filters as suggested by the producer to maintain ideal suction and efficiency.
- Prepare the Floor: Before each cleaning cycle, eliminate clutter like cables, small toys, and loose items that might obstruct the robot vacuum or get tangled in its brushes.
- Utilize Virtual Boundaries and No-Go Zones: Use virtual limits or physical border strips (if supported) to avoid the robot vacuum from entering areas you don't want cleaned up or getting stuck in troublesome spots.
- Explore Scheduling: Optimize your cleaning schedule based on your lifestyle and home traffic patterns. Consider scheduling cleansings when you run out your house to reduce disturbance.
- Keep Software Updated: For smart robot vacuums, guarantee you keep the firmware and app upgraded to benefit from the latest features, improvements, and bug fixes.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s) about Automatic Vacuum Cleaners
- How frequently should I run my robot vacuum? For ideal cleanliness, running your robot vacuum everyday or every other day is suggested, specifically in households with animals or high foot traffic.
- Can robot vacuums handle pet hair? Yes, numerous robot vacuums are specifically created for pet hair with functions like tangle-free brushes and strong suction. Models specifically marketed for pet owners typically perform best.
- Do robot vacuums deal with carpets? Yes, a lot of robot vacuums work on carpets and difficult floorings. The effectiveness on carpets can differ depending on the suction power and brush type. Higher-end models with more powerful suction and specialized brushes carry out much better on carpets.
- For how long do robot vacuum cleaners uk vacuums last? The lifespan of a robot vacuum can vary depending upon the brand name, model, usage, and maintenance. Normally, you can anticipate a well-maintained robot vacuum to last for 3-5 years, or perhaps longer.
- Are robot cleaner vacuums worth the money? For lots of people, the benefit, time cost savings, and constant cleaning provided by robot vacuums make them a rewarding financial investment. Consider your lifestyle, cleaning needs, and spending plan to identify if a robot vacuum is the ideal option for you.
